McMinns Lagoon NT — Property Data and Demographics

McMinns Lagoon (postcode 0822) is a close-knit residential community in Northern Territory within the Litchfield local government area. It is home to about 687 residents, with a settled mid-life population and a median age of 43. Households earn a median income of $131K per year, with an average household size of 2.9 people. Recent annual estimates show population movement into the broader catchment, with population growth running at +2.2% year-on-year at the LGA level. NT employment has moved +3.3% year-on-year in the official ABS Labour Force trend series, which provides the broader jobs backdrop for this suburb. NT also had 4 Commonwealth-backed major projects under construction, 3 underway, and 4 in planning as at 2025-09-01, which is useful as a broader delivery backdrop rather than a suburb-specific project count. The most common occupations are technicians & trades, managers, clerical & administrative. Employment in the area leans toward construction and public admin & safety. The top ancestries reported are Australian, English, Scottish.

The median weekly rent is $400 (Census 2021). The median monthly mortgage repayment is $2,708.

Public transport access includes 5 bus stops.
